Solution Train Engineer
Unisity, LLC is a Service-Disabled Veteran Owned Small Business providing expert services in the Information Technology fields. They are seeking an experienced Solution Train Engineer to facilitate operations for a large program using the Scaled Agile Framework (SAFe). The role involves leading agile teams, monitoring performance, and driving improvements while ensuring effective communication with stakeholders.
Information Services
Responsibilities
Facilitate Solution Train and Agile Release Train (ART) operations using the Scaled Agile Framework (SAFe) for a Solution Train and three ARTs
Work with the SAFe governance layer participants & stakeholders on program execution
Facilitate allocation of work and new resources to ARTs
Monitor program performance, resolve impediments, and develop and implement solutions for driving improvement
Coordinate schedule execution and plan program-wide software/architecture releases
Lead/facilitate Program Increment (PI) Planning, including logistics and technical preparation
Lead/facilitate Solution Train planning events and pre- and post- planning meetings
Lead/facilitate cross-team collaboration within the program via Scrum of Scrums meetings and other less formal forums in support of development, testing, and deployment efforts
Track the execution of features and capabilities through Metrics across the program's agile and DevOps teams
Brief customers on the development progress throughout the PI cycle on program status, including the status of testing, deployment, and release readiness
Assess skillset needs and collaborate with leadership to staff program openings
Provide input on resourcing to address critical bottlenecks
Coach teams, Scrum Masters, Product Owners, and Project/Program Leaders in agile practices
Promote teamwork to achieve PI goals
Guide teams towards agile maturity
Foster Communities of Practice and the use of engineering and Built-In Quality practices
